Frequently Asked Questions
- Where can I find government surplus auctions in Georgia?
- Government surplus auctions in Georgia are listed on GSA Auctions (federal surplus), HUD HomeStore (foreclosed properties), GovDeals, Public Surplus, and the State of Georgia's own surplus platform. Right now the 2,242 open Georgia lots come from GovDeals (1743), J.J. Kane Auctioneers (243), GovPlanet (103), Public Surplus (39), and 5 other official platforms. GovAuctions aggregates them into one free, searchable feed, and you bid on the original platform.

- Are government auctions in Georgia legit?
- Yes - every listing on this page links directly to an official government auction platform (GSA, HUD, GovDeals, Public Surplus). There are no bid packs, credits, or "pay to access" schemes. GovAuctions is a free search layer on top of these official platforms; you bid on the original site.
- Are government auctions in Georgia open to the public?
- Yes. Government surplus auctions in Georgia are open to the public. Anyone can register and bid on items through official platforms like GSA Auctions. No special license is required.
